STEP 18 Always dry fit parts first Align parts carefully 1- Glue F1B balsa doubler in front of F1 as shown. 2- Locate engine holes plate and drill holes in F1. Engine plates are provided for Evolution33 and DLE35 engines. Select as per the engine of your choice. Engine holes plate can also be glued to F1 as a spacer for the engine or use wood standoff to locate the engine at proper distance from F1 to node of fuselage.

STEP 26 Always dry fit parts first Align parts carefully 1- Install (2) 4-40 blind nuts on F29 as shown 2- Install (1) 6-32 blind nut as shown 3- Locate F29 assy under the FB1 as shown. 4- Using 4-40 SHCS and washers, fix the F29 assembly to the fuselage. This setup will allow installation and removal of fuel tank.

ENGINE SERVOS INSTALLATION You should use 1 for choke and 1 for throttle 1- Make 2 assembly of SS1 servo plate with SS2 parts as shown. Glue SS3 on one side of each assembly. 2- Glue Servo tray as shown over removable servo plate F15 3- Hook servo to engine as required by engine manufacturers You can use Sullivan golden rods for engine controls.

C.G and Control Throws -CG: LOCATED DIRECTLY IN THE CENTER OF THE WING TUBE -Control throw: high rate low rate Aileron : 1 up/down Elevator : 1 ½ up/down Rudder : 2 ½ left/right -Use 35% exponential on al surfaces. -Final weight of the plane is around 13/14 pounds (may vary depending on builder choices) -Recommended engines: Any good 26 to 40CC engine are suitable for this plane.
